Job Title: Customer Service Representative / Inventory Coordinator Location:
DTLA Industry:
Jewelry
Job Summary: We are seeking a detail-oriented and customer-focused professional to join our team as a
Customer Service Representative / Inventory Coordinator . This dual-role position is ideal for someone with prior experience in the
jewelry industry , who understands the unique requirements of fine jewelry handling, terminology, and customer expectations. The successful candidate will be responsible for providing exceptional customer support while also managing inventory processes with accuracy and efficiency. Key Responsibilities:
Customer Service:
Respond to customer inquiries via phone, email, or in person in a timely and professional manner Assist clients with product information, order status, returns, and repairs Maintain a strong knowledge of the jewelry product lines, materials, and industry terminology Work closely with sales and production teams to ensure customer satisfaction Handle high-value transactions and sensitive customer concerns with discretion and care Inventory Coordination:
Track, manage, and reconcile inventory of jewelry items using inventory management systems Conduct regular inventory counts and audits to ensure accuracy Coordinate incoming and outgoing shipments, including repairs and special orders Maintain organized records of stock levels, locations, and movement Assist with labeling, tagging, and quality control of new inventory Requirements: Previous experience in the jewelry industry is required
(retail, wholesale, manufacturing, or repair) Strong customer service and communication skills High attention to detail and ability to multitask Proficiency in inventory software and MS Office (Excel, Outlook, etc.) Ability to handle fine jewelry with care and understand product details (e.g., gemstones, metals, sizing) Comfortable working in a fast-paced, team-oriented environment Preferred Qualifications: Experience with jewelry-specific POS or inventory systems (e.g., The Edge, Lightspeed, etc.) Knowledge of GIA or other gemological certifications Bilingual a plus
